Transaction 14aea376367b406632f6009eb16d641f3c2470c8bcfd44853454af8d0669fe64
1 Input
1 Output
-
14aea376367b406632f6009eb16d641f3c2470c8bcfd44853454af8d0669fe64:0
- value
- 72988
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ea90131698030431a431541ac7a711e80ea96f8
- address
- bc1qp65szvtfsqcyxxjrz4q6c7n3r6qw49hcwhe68k